MangaGamer Releases Demo Movie for Ef ~The First Tale~

April 2012--We at MangaGamer are proud to announce the release of a demo video for ef!

As our release of ef ~The First Tale~ draws near, we're proud to present the game's English demo video so fans can enjoy a look at its artwork by Naru Nanao and animation by Makoto Shinkai. More information about the upcoming release as well as a message from minori to their western fans can be found on our staff blog.

Story Otowa, a city once razed by a devastating earthquake and the resultant fires. A beautiful European cityscape now marks the present, as if it were from a fairy tale; almost as if to mask the memories of that calamity...

Prologue: A beginning of the story "ef - a fairy tale of the two"

The night before Christmas. A man visited a church in Otowa. He was to fulfill a promise made in the distant past. A woman greeted him. The two of them calmly talked about their bygone days.

"Each step of life would be taken together." "That was what we thought." "But then..." "Our hands drifted apart, yet they arrived here through unique paths."

What happened in the time they were separated? They were there to find out.

The girl said,

"It was during this time, one year ago. Those doors opened, and he wandered in from the cold. It was a lone young man. A part of him resembled you... Yes, there was a pining essence within. That may be why I acted the way I did. For a short time, I thought I would involve myself in his fairy tale."

Chapter 1: Otowa - Winter

Hiro Hirono is not only a full-time student, but also a professional shoujo manga artist. On the night of Christmas Eve, he happened upon two women. The first, Yuuko Amamiya, was a mysterious lady who continued to wait for someone at the church. The other, Miyako Miyamura, was a girl who had her purse stolen and snatched Hiro's bicycle to pursue the culprit.

This winter, Hiro will waver between his artistic dreams and the reality of school. Upon seeing each other again at Otowa Collegiate, Miyako presented Hiro this question: "It's all too much for one person. Can't you just run away from it all?" He will be charmed by the free-spirited Miyako, who is bound by nothing. However, there is yet another girl with her eyes on him: Kei Shindou, whom he thinks of as a sister and a childhood friend. This driven and confident girl, a starter of the basketball team despite her short stature, will try to show Hiro another path.

These students will coalesce within this idyllic school life. Their relationships will be taken a step further, yet what has tied them together is about to become hopelessly tangled.

The choice between dreams and reality... His heart torn between two girls... Hiro must find a single solution for these two conflicts.

Chapter 2: Otowa - Summer

Half a year after the events of the first chapter, the passage of time brings both new relationships and the birth of a new tale.

The girl who became hurt by the events at the conclusion of winter met a young man named Kyousuke Tsutsumi. A cameraman in the film club, he was usually rather aloof, but the objective view passing through his lens didn't overlook a fairy tale that hadn't quite seen its finale.

Hiro Hirono had grown since the first chapter, and Yuuko Amamiya was still waiting. While watching over everyone, she took it upon herself to take action once more.

The fairy tale was not yet over.

The man with eyes filled with hatred asked her: "...Who ARE you?"

The truth is revealed in ef - a fairy tale of the two. Another summer and winter will pass in the next part: ef - the latter tale. Only then will the tale come to its conclusion.

ef ~The First Tale~ Manufacturer: Minori
Genre: Adventure
Price: €24.95
OS: Windows XP(32bit), Windows Vista(32bit), Windows 7(32bit)
Text Language: English
Voice Language: Japanese
Age Rating: 18 and over

ABOUT MANGAGAMER.COM MangaGamer.com is the world's first legal download site for English translated Visual Novels. Since its launch in July 2008, it has offered services where fans can download and enjoy popular Visual Novels such as CIRCUS's Da Capo and OVERDRIVE's Kira Kira right from their home.
